General Services
The physicians and staff of Quakertown Orthopaedic Associates provide high quality care for musculoskeletal disorders, using both surgical and nonsurgical treatments. We treat a full range of conditions and offer services from minor procedures to advanced surgery.
Conditions & Procedures
If you have a question about a service or specialty you do not see listed, please call our office to discuss your specific needs.
- Total joint replacement and reconstruction
- Computer-assisted minimally invasuve surgery
- Primary and reconstructive surgery of the spine
- Fracture care
- Sports injuries
- Rheumatologic conditions
- Traumatic injuries

Insurances/Referrals
We accept most major insurance plans, including several managed care plans (HMOs). Most insurance plans require a referral to our surgical practice from your primary care physician. In most cases, we are not permitted to see you without a written referral and you should be prepared to provide it at the time of your initial consultation. Retroactive referrals cannot be issued for care already received. If you do not have the appropriate referral at the time of your visit, you may be required to reschedule your appointment.
